Shrimp Cocktail

This Shrimp Cocktail platter is perfectly seasoned & savory, it's the ultimate party appetizer!

Ingredients

  • 1 ½ pounds jumbo shrimp
  • 6 cups water
  • 2 ribs celery
  • 2 tablespoons kosher salt
  • 3 prigs fresh thyme
  • 2 prigs fresh parsley
  • 1 teaspoon black peppercorns
  • 1 bay leaf
  • ½ lemon
  • ice
  • Lemon wedges and cocktail sauce for serving, optional

Instructions

    Cup of Yum
  1. Place 6 cups of water in a saucepan. Add celery, salt, thyme, parsley, peppercorns, and bay leaf. Bring to a boil and let simmer 10 minutes (while you prepare the shrimp if needed).
  2. If your shrimp have the shells on, you will need to remove the shell leaving the tail intact. To prepare shrimp, cut the top of the shrimp shell along the back all the way down to the tail. Remove the shell leaving the tail in place. Place a small knife under the black vein and remove and discard it. Repeat with remaining shrimp.
  3. Add one half lemon and shrimp to the simmering water. Immediately remove from heat and cover.
  4. Let rest covered until shrimp are pink and firm, about 3-4 minutes for jumbo shrimp.
  5. Use a slotted spoon to move shrimp into the ice bath and cool completely.
  6. Once cold, serve shrimp with lemon wedges and cocktail sauce or refrigerate up to 24 hours before serving.

Notes

  • Jumbo shrimp should show 16 to 20 per pound on the package.
  • Jumbo shrimp need 3-4 minutes to cook through. Smaller shrimp may only need 2-3 minutes.
  • The ice bath stops the shrimp from overcooking keeping it tender and juicy, don't skip this step!
